Watch the on-location video of 2007 Hindi film 'Ek Chalis Ki Last Local' starring Abhay Deol and Neha Dhupia in lead roles. It is a comedy thriller film directed by Sanjay Khanduri. It released on 18 May 2007. The film received a good response from the critics and has been labeled a cult classic in the Hindi cinema. In this video, Abhay Deol and Neha Dhupia can be seen shooting for a promo song. Music is given by a Pakistani band called 'Call Band.' Ganesh Acharya can be seen choreographing the peppy song. #AbhayDeol #NehaDhupia #GaneshAcharya